Common Admission Requirements For Barber SchoolsIn Lebanon, Oregon

If you’re considering enrolling in a barber school in Lebanon, Oregon, it’s helpful to be aware of common admission requirements. While specific requirements can vary from one institution to another, here are some typical prerequisites:

  • Age Requirement: Most programs require applicants to be at least 16 years old to apply, though some may mandate a high school diploma or GED for admission.

  • Educational Background: A high school diploma or equivalent is often required, along with basic coursework in subjects such as mathematics and communication.

  • Application Process: Interested candidates typically need to submit a completed application form, which may include a personal statement or essay outlining their interest in barbering.

  • Background Check: Some schools may require a criminal background check due to the nature of the profession, particularly since barbers often work with clients’ personal grooming.

  • Health Requirements: Proof of vaccinations and a health screening may be necessary, especially considering the close contacts within barber services.

  • Certification: Many programs involve obtaining a valid barbering license upon completion of training, which requires passing a state examination. Familiarize yourself with the requirements for licensure in Oregon as part of your preparation.

To ensure a smooth admission process, always check specific requirements with the school you plan to attend.

Cost & Financial Aid Options For Barber Schools In Lebanon, Oregon

Enrolling in a barber school in Lebanon, Oregon, involves financial considerations. Tuition costs can vary widely based on the program's duration, location, and offered facilities. Here’s an overview of the financial aspects:

  • Tuition Ranges: Annual tuition costs for barbering programs can range from $10,000 to $20,000, depending on the school. This typically covers instructional materials, equipment, and practical training experiences.

  • Additional Costs: Aside from tuition, students should budget for additional expenses, including textbooks, tools, uniforms, and potential licensing fees, which can add up to a few thousand dollars.

  • Financial Aid Options: Many schools offer financial aid resources, including:

    • Federal Financial Aid: Eligible students can apply for federal grants and loans by submitting the FAFSA (Free Application for Federal Student Aid).
    • State Grants: Oregon provides several state-funded grants for eligible students attending vocational programs, including barber schools.
    • Scholarships: Research local and national scholarships aimed at aspiring barbers, which could significantly reduce educational costs.
    • Payment Plans: Some schools offer payment plans that allow students to spread out tuition payments throughout the program.

Exploring these options early will help make education more attainable and ensure a successful start to your barbering career.

Frequently Asked Questions (FAQs) About Barber Schools In Lebanon, Oregon

  1. What is the typical length of barber programs in Lebanon, Oregon?

    • Barber programs generally take 9 to 12 months to complete, contingent upon full-time enrollment.
  2. Do I need a high school diploma to enroll in a barber program?

    • Yes, most schools require a high school diploma or GED as a prerequisite for admission.
  3. What types of skills will I learn in barbering school?

    • Skills taught include cutting techniques, shaving, hair coloring, and knowledge of grooming products.
  4. Are there online barbering programs available?

    • While some theory may be offered online, practical training must typically be completed in-person.
  5. What will my earning potential be as a barber?

    • Earnings can vary widely, but barbers in Oregon typically earn between $30,000 and $50,000 annually based on experience and clientele.
  6. How do I obtain my barbering license in Oregon?

    • After completing a barber program, you must pass a state examination to receive your license.
  7. Can I take continuing education courses after becoming a barber?

    • Yes, many barbers participate in workshops and courses to keep their skills current and learn about the latest trends.
  8. Is there a job placement service after graduation?

    • Many barber schools in Lebanon offer job placement assistance to help graduates find employment.
  9. Can I start my own barbershop after completing my training?

    • Yes, many graduates start their own businesses, especially if they gain experience working in established shops first.
  10. What are the hygiene and safety guidelines I must follow as a barber?

    • Barbers are required to follow guidelines set by the Oregon Health Authority, including sanitation practices and proper handling of tools.
